目的研究孝感地区丙型肝炎病毒(HCV)基因分型特点及临床意义。方法收集2011年6月-2015年6月孝感地区398例HCV患者的临床资料和外周静脉血,采用RT-PCR法测定HCVRNA含量,采用sanger测序法检测HCV基因型,用双试剂速率法检测肝功能指标ALT、AST,对所测数据进行统计分析。结果孝感地区患者HCV存在7种基因型,以1b型最多占71.11%,其次2a型占16.33%,HCV、HBV重叠感染中HCV基因型以基因型1b2a为主,其所占比率比单纯HCV感染要高,差异有统计学意义(P<0.01),HCV感染患者中男性感染1b型的比率高于女性,女性感染2a型的比率高于男性,差异有统计学意义(P<0.01);HCV感染患者年龄段主要分布在30~60岁,不同年龄段均以感染HCV1b型为主,HCV的不同传播途径中经血液透析、母婴垂直传播为1b和2a型,经输血和性传播的有6种基因型,静脉吸毒、其他途径、不明原因传播的有7种基因型,呈散在分布;HCV1型感染患者血清HCV-RNA载量比2、3、6型要高(P<0.01),HCV1型感染患者血浆ALT含量比2型、3型、6型血浆ALT含量高(P<0.01)。结论孝感地区患者HCV基因分型呈分散多样化,以1b型为主,HCV基因分型、病毒载量、传染途径以及对肝脏的损伤程度对临床诊疗有重要价值,为本地区慢性丙肝患者评估病情、制订个体化治疗方案提供依据。
Objective To study the genotyping and clinical significance of hepatitis C virus (HCV) in Xiaogan area. Methods The clinical data and peripheral venous blood samples from 398 patients with HCV in Xiaogan area from June 2011 to June 2015 were collected. The HCV RNA content was determined by RT-PCR, the HCV genotype was detected by Sanger sequencing, Function indicators ALT, AST, the measured data for statistical analysis. Results There were 7 genotypes of HCV in Xiaogan region, accounting for 71.11% in type 1b and 16.33% in type 2a. HCV genotypes were predominantly genotype 1b2a in HCV and HBV infection, which was higher than HCV infection (P <0.01). The prevalence of genotype 1b was higher in women with HCV infection than in women, and the prevalence of genotype 2a in women with HCV infection was significantly higher than that in men (P <0.01). HCV Infected patients mainly in the age group 30 to 60 years of age, all infected with HCV1b-based at different ages, HCV in different transmission routes by hemodialysis, mother and baby vertical transmission of 1b and 2a type, transfusions and sexually transmitted There were 7 genotypes in 6 genotypes, intravenous drug use, other ways and unknown reasons. The HCV-RNA load of patients with HCV1 infection was higher than that of 2, 3 and 6 (P <0.01) Patients with HCV1 infection had higher plasma levels of ALT than those with type 2, 3 and 6 plasma (P <0.01). Conclusion The genotypes of HCV in Xiaogan area are scattered and diversified. The main genotype 1b is genotype 1b. HCV genotyping, viral load, route of infection and liver damage are of great value in clinical diagnosis and treatment. Condition, to develop individualized treatment programs provide the basis.
